The Many Names of Affordable Sneakers
The term ‘cheap sneakers’ is broad. It encompasses various styles, brands, and price points. Let’s break down the common names and phrases used to describe them:
Budget Sneakers
This is a straightforward term. It simply refers to sneakers that are priced affordably. These shoes prioritize cost-effectiveness. They often use less expensive materials and simpler construction methods. This doesn’t necessarily mean they’re low quality. Many budget sneakers still offer excellent value for the price. They are ideal for everyday wear, casual activities, and for people who want to save money.
Value Sneakers
Value sneakers emphasize the balance between price and quality. These shoes aim to provide the best possible features for the money. They might incorporate durable materials, comfortable designs, and stylish aesthetics. Brands often compete to offer the best value proposition, making this category a great place to find hidden gems. Value sneakers are a good choice for those who want a good deal without sacrificing too much performance or style.
Discount Sneakers
Discount sneakers are shoes sold at reduced prices. This may be due to sales, clearance events, or seasonal promotions. These can be new or overstock items. They offer an excellent opportunity to buy popular brands and models at lower prices. Discount sneakers are often found at outlet stores, online retailers, and during special sales events. Shopping smart can lead to huge savings.
Economy Sneakers
Economy sneakers are designed with cost-efficiency in mind. They usually feature basic designs and materials. While they may not have all the bells and whistles of premium sneakers, they excel in providing essential functionality at a low price. They’re perfect for basic needs, such as walking, light exercise, or simply getting around. They are a good choice for those who need reliable footwear without spending a lot.
Entry-Level Sneakers
Entry-level sneakers are a great starting point for beginners. These are shoes designed for casual use or light activities. They are typically priced lower than more specialized models. They offer a comfortable and functional option for everyday wear. Entry-level sneakers are often a good option for kids’ shoes or those who are new to a particular sport or activity.
Affordable Sneakers
This is a general term that encompasses all the above categories. Affordable sneakers focus on accessibility. They are designed to meet the needs of budget-conscious shoppers. They are available in a variety of styles and designs, ensuring that there’s an affordable option for everyone. They represent a broad range of footwear, providing great choices for various budgets.

Key Features to Consider When Buying Cheap Sneakers
When shopping for cheap sneakers, keep in mind these key features:
Material
The material affects the sneaker’s durability, comfort, and breathability.
- Synthetic Materials: Often used in budget sneakers. They are durable and affordable.
- Canvas: Lightweight and breathable, but less durable than other materials.
- Leather: More durable but often found in higher-priced sneakers. Look for faux leather options.
Consider the intended use of the sneakers when choosing the material. For everyday wear, synthetic materials or canvas may be sufficient. For more rigorous activities, choose more durable materials.
Comfort
Comfort is essential, especially if you plan to wear your sneakers for long periods. Consider the following:
- Cushioning: Look for sneakers with cushioned insoles and midsoles.
- Support: Ensure the sneakers provide adequate arch support.
- Fit: Make sure the sneakers fit properly. Try them on and walk around before buying.
Prioritize comfort to prevent foot fatigue and discomfort.
Durability
Choose sneakers that can withstand wear and tear. Consider the following:
- Outsole: Look for durable rubber outsoles.
- Construction: Check the stitching and construction of the shoe.
- Materials: Consider the materials used and their durability.
Durability will help your sneakers last longer, providing better value for your money.

Sneaker Care and Maintenance
Proper care and maintenance can extend the lifespan of your cheap sneakers. Here are some tips:
Cleaning
Clean your sneakers regularly. Use a mild soap and water solution. Avoid harsh chemicals that can damage the materials. Use a soft brush to remove dirt and grime. Allow your sneakers to air dry completely.
Storage
Store your sneakers in a cool, dry place. Avoid direct sunlight and extreme temperatures. Use shoe trees to maintain their shape.
Protection
Use a protectant spray to repel water and stains. This will help keep your sneakers looking new. Reapply the protectant spray as needed.
Rotation
Rotate your sneakers to prevent excessive wear and tear. Don’t wear the same pair every day. Allow your sneakers to rest and air out between uses.
Repair
Repair any damage promptly. Replace worn-out laces. Seek professional repair for more significant damage. Addressing issues quickly can prevent further damage.
